Domande frequenti: Brew vs Make vs Prepare

Qual è la differenza tra Brew, Make e Prepare?

Brew: To make a drink, usually tea or coffee. Make: to create or build something Prepare: to get ready for something

Puoi mostrare un esempio di ciascuna?

Brew: I like to brew my own coffee every morning. Make: I want to make a cake for your birthday. Prepare: I need to prepare a presentation for the meeting tomorrow.

Posso usare Brew, Make e Prepare in modo intercambiabile?

Non sempre. Brew, Make e Prepare sono affini e a volte si sovrappongono, ma differiscono per registro, frequenza e uso, quindi scambiarle può cambiare il significato o il tono. Controlla le differenze qui sopra prima di sostituire.
